description
The Adoption and Special Guardianship Leadership Board (ASGLB) was established in 2014 as the Adoption Leadership Board. Its aim was to provide leadership to the adoption system and drive improvements in performance. It was chaired by Sir Martin Narey up until March 2016. Andrew Christie has been the ASGLB Chair since April 2016. In 2018 the Board expanded its remit to cover those children subject to a Special Guardianship Order who were previously in care and subsequently changed its name to the Adoption and Special Guardianship Leadership Board.
The Residential Care Leadership Board (RCLB) was established in 2017 in response to Sir Martin Narey's 2016 review of children's residential care in England. Its aim is to drive forward improvements to the children's residential care system and support vulnerable children across the country. It is chaired by Sir Alan Wood.
The National Stability Forum (NSF) was established in 2018. It is a new Board, chaired by the Department for Education's Director General of Social Care, Mobility and Disadvantage with the aim of improving stability for all children in the orbit of the care system, leading to better outcomes for those children and to more children finding the right permanent placement.
The required service will continue and expand upon the existing management service for the ASGLB and its Chair, which includes the running of the secretariat and the collection and publication of a quarterly adoption statistical release. In addition to this, the new service will provide support to two other Boards and their respective Chairs - the RCLB and the NSF.
